Now, let’s shift gears to the nitty-gritty of functional features:
Smart Storage:
Wall shelves, overhead racks, and organized tool areas. Because a messy garage is like a bad hair day – it ruins the whole look.
Multi-Functional Workbench:
Combine car parking with a workspace. It’s perfect for DIY lovers who can’t decide between tinkering with cars or crafting.
Cozy Lounge Corner:
Add a small sofa or beanbags. Because sometimes you need a pit stop between projects.
Creative Lighting:
Neon wall signs, spotlights, and under-shelf LEDs. Light it up like it’s the hottest car show in town.
Themed Decor:
Pick a unifying theme – sports, industrial, retro, or coastal. It’s like giving your garage its own personality.
Outdoor Access:
Direct doors or sliders to connect the garage and driveway. Because why should your car have all the fun going in and out?
Let’s break down the design process:
Focal Points:
Place your main car or model front and center. It’s the automotive equivalent of “if you’ve got it, flaunt it.”
Supporting Decor:
Wall-mounted cabinets, pegboards for tools, and organized bins. Keep it tidy, folks – we’re building a garage, not recreating that one episode of “Hoarders.”
Flooring:
Try epoxy textures, checkered tiles, or concrete. Make it look so good you’ll feel bad driving on it.
Wall Details:
Consider accent walls with paneling, stone, or paint. Because blank walls are as exciting as watching paint dry (which, ironically, you might be doing).
Styling Tips:
- Color-coordinate your accessories. It’s like playing matchmaker with your storage boxes and tool racks.
- Layer textures with floor mats, metal shelves, and wooden accents. Mix it up like you’re DJ-ing a design party.
- Add plants for freshness. Because even virtual garages need some green to keep it clean.
Functional Elements:
- Add a bike rack, workbench, or laundry corner. Multi-tasking isn’t just for people anymore.
- If space allows, build a small fitness zone or hobby nook. Who says you can’t pump iron while admiring your virtual wheels?
Lighting:
- Big windows or glass doors for natural light. Let the sunshine in – your virtual tan will thank you.
- Ceiling-mounted fixtures, LED strips, or under-cabinet lighting for mood and utility. Set the scene like you’re directing a car commercial.
Budget-Friendly Tips:
- Starter layouts can begin at 4k-10k Bloxburg bucks. That’s cheaper than a real oil change!
- Repurpose common props – kitchen cabinets for storage, office chairs for a workshop. It’s like upcycling, but without the heavy lifting.
- For killer photos, use in-game daytime, angle lights at key features, and try overhead views. Become the Annie Leibovitz of Bloxburg garages.
